After thinking about a bunch of pop-culture references, back-spacing, intentional humor attempts, it finally dawned upon me that I don’t really need to write a click-baity introduction or try too hard. Whatever little time I’ve spent in the advertising industry, digital to be precise, has mentally conditioned me to always begin any content piece with an introduction, end with a parting thought and sell my brand as much as I can.

So, I’m going to try doing things a little differently here, literally typing what my mind dictates me to. This is my version of magic in mundane. To enunciate this better: little satisfying things in your regular mundane life that you fail to appreciate enough. Here goes:

  1. Preparing your best comebacks/solo performances/future TED talks in the shower. Let no amount of hair fall and strands sticking all over your body stop you.
  2. Poha & Chai for breakfast is good. Eating a spoonful of Poha, taking a sip of Chai and chewing it all together in your mouth is better.
  3. Those 45 minutes in the morning spent while traveling to work, headphones plugged in, not a care about what’s planned ahead, what was left behind. Prepare mental dance moves, think about something, think about nothing, the world is yours and only yours.
  4. When the office boy is ready with a cup of coffee, within the exact 15 minutes you’ve entered your workplace. I’m no Batman, but I’d never say no to having my own Alfred.
  5. Lunch-time. Because food. Because complementing it by watching the series you’ve previously binge-watched, at least twice is so much fun.
  6. Hugs that feel like home: From that special someone, from Mom, from your imaginary dog (no, I don’t have any issues), friends like family, all of them. Bring them on!
  7. Men & women have 1 thing in common: Both are happiest when a woman takes off her bra. Ladies, you know you love it when you finally come home after a long day at work and take off that bra! I know I do.
  8. A good dinner. Never to be under-estimated, just like a good breakfast.
  9. Realizing that it’s Saturday and you don’t have to be at work tomorrow.
  10. Sleep. You know what’s a real badass thing to do though? Not setting an alarm, even when there’s office the next day. *moonwalks her way out*

What’s your version of magic in mundane?
